    The Conversion: 40 Pounds to Kilograms

    The simple answer to "How many kilograms is 40 pounds?" is approximately 18.14 kilograms.

    This conversion is based on the standard conversion factor:

    • 1 pound (lb) ≈ 0.453592 kilograms (kg)

    Therefore, to convert 40 pounds to kilograms, you multiply 40 by 0.453592:

    40 lbs * 0.453592 kg/lb ≈ 18.14368 kg

    For most practical purposes, rounding to 18.14 kg is perfectly acceptable.

    Converting Other Weights:

    The same principle applies to converting other weights from pounds to kilograms. Simply multiply the weight in pounds by the conversion factor (0.453592 kg/lb). For example:

    • 20 pounds = 20 lbs * 0.453592 kg/lb ≈ 9.07 kg
    • 60 pounds = 60 lbs * 0.453592 kg/lb ≈ 27.22 kg
    • 100 pounds = 100 lbs * 0.453592 kg/lb ≈ 45.36 kg
